Position : Virtual Scheduler Location : Remote Type : Full-Time / Part-Time Job Summary : As a Virtual Scheduler at Voyage Canvas, you will play a critical role in ensuring the seamless execution of our bespoke travel itineraries and events.

You will be responsible for the meticulous planning, scheduling, and coordination of all logistics, ensuring that every aspect of our clients' experiences is flawlessly executed.

This position requires a highly organized, detail-oriented individual with exceptional communication and problem-solving skills.

Key Responsibilities : Schedule Management : Create and maintain comprehensive schedules for travel itineraries and events, including accommodations, transportation, activities, and dining reservations.

Vendor Coordination : Liaise with vendors, partners, and service providers to secure bookings and confirm details, ensuring that all arrangements meet Voyage Canvas's high standards.

Client Communication : Work closely with the client service team to communicate schedule changes, updates, and confirmations to clients promptly.

Problem-Solving : Proactively identify potential scheduling conflicts or issues and develop effective solutions to 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ience for our clients.

Quality Control : Conduct regular checks on scheduled arrangements to verify accuracy and quality, making adjustments as necessary to uphold the company's reputation for excellence.

Documentation :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of all scheduling activities, including contracts, confirmations, and client communications.

Team Collaboration : Collaborate with other departments, including client services, finance, and marketing, to ensure a cohesive and integrated approach to service delivery.

Qualifications :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in hospitality, tourism, event management, or a related field.

Proven experience in scheduling, logistics, or operations, preferably in the travel, hospitality, or events industry.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to interact effectively with clients, vendors, and team members.

Proficiency in scheduling software and Microsoft Office Suite.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
